Essential Gardening Tips for Hanwell Residents

For beginners and seasoned gardeners alike, having a set of practical tips is crucial. One basic piece of advice is to start with well-prepared soil. The success of any garden in Hanwell depends on ensuring that the soil is rich in nutrients and properly aerated.

The local climate in Hanwell can vary greatly, so it is always recommended to choose plants that are well adapted to the temperature and rainfall patterns. Seasonal planning, from choosing the best bulbs in autumn to planting vegetables in spring, can maximize yield and beauty.

Watering practices are another important aspect. Gardeners are encouraged to water in the early morning or late evening to reduce evaporation loss. Moreover, installing a drip system can help conserve water and deliver it directly to the plant roots.

Embracing Eco-Friendly Practices

The shift towards sustainability is a key trend among Gardeners Hanwell. By choosing organic fertilizers and pesticides, local gardeners are contributing to a healthier ecosystem. These choices also benefit local wildlife, from bees to butterflies, and help maintain biodiversity.

Organic compost made from kitchen scraps and garden waste is a popular method to enrich the soil. This practice not only reduces waste but also ensures that the soil remains fertile and robust enough for future planting seasons.

Gardening with recycled materials is another innovative idea. From repurposing old containers as planters to creating raised beds from reclaimed wood, there are many ways to embrace an eco-friendly lifestyle without having to sacrifice style or functionality.

Adapting to Seasonal Changes

Understanding the rhythm of the seasons is crucial for successful gardening in Hanwell. Each season brings its own set of challenges and opportunities for enthusiasts. For example, autumn is a great time to enrich the soil, while spring offers an opportunity to plant a variety of flowering species.

Gardeners must be vigilant during winter. Protective mulches, cold frames, and greenhouses help ensure that delicate plants survive the frost. These adaptations ultimately lead to flourishing gardens when the weather warms up.

Summer care is equally important. With high temperatures, regular watering and attention to soil moisture become key factors in maintaining vibrant greenery. This cyclical understanding and adaptation embody the resilient spirit of Gardeners Hanwell.
